Find the x-intercept and the y-intercept of the graph of each equation. Then graph the equation.

y=-3x-5

Step by step solution

01

– Definition of intercepts.

The x-intercept is the point where the graph intersect the x-axis. It is the value of x when y=0.

The y-intercept is the point where the graph intersect the y-axis. It is the value of y when x=0.

02

– Find the x-intercept.

The given equation is:

y=-3x-5

Substitute y=0 in the given equation.

0=3x53x=53x3=53x=53

The x-intercept is -53. The graph crosses the x-axis at -53,0.

03

– Find the y-intercept.

Substitute x=0 in the given equation.

y=3(0)5y=05y=5

The y-intercept is -5. The graph crosses the y-axis at 0,-5.
